Output a844059e1261d56bcba70431566c52cc367fc503ad63fab7125f5175e73f8fd1:0

value
514900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8699126f5e4ad822da20400b58bd6bdecb33be1 OP_EQUAL
address
3QLVy3MreJeZJZLcd6QbXtfXB9xhaTPZMT
transaction
a844059e1261d56bcba70431566c52cc367fc503ad63fab7125f5175e73f8fd1
spent
true